"We're also you know scaling inference we're seeing scaling inference almost has no wall... I think there will be compute clause [costs]." The next wave of AI development is moving beyond simple chatbots into formal mathematical verification and agentic reasoning. These processes require models to "think" step-by-step, which demands massive, continuous inference compute. Startups are raising hundreds of millions of dollars specifically to funnel into these compute costs, directly benefiting Nvidia's hardware monopoly. LONG. The shift from pre-training to inference-heavy reasoning models creates a virtually limitless ceiling for GPU compute demand. Hyperscalers successfully develop and deploy custom silicon (ASICs) that offload inference workloads from Nvidia GPUs at a significantly lower cost.
